- Riddles
1. Forty sheep went through a gap
Forty more went after that.
Six, seven, ten, eleven, two , three,
how much is that
Answer = Five.2. What goes up and down and up and down and neither touches sky or ground?
Answer = A latch of a door3. As I went up to Dublin
I saw an awful wonder
Two or three wild geese
Pulling wool a sunder
Answer = A man harrowing4. As I went through a guttery gap
I met my uncle David
But off his head and sucked his blood
And left his body easy
Answer = A bottle of whiskey5. What goes round and round the house
and sleeps in the corner at night?
Answer = A twig- Collector
